The Birth of a Cultural Hub

The Centro Arti Visive Pescheria was established in 1996, thanks to the vision of artist Loreno Seguaci and the support of Pesaro's then-mayor, Oriano Giovanelli. Their ambition was to create a space that would not only exhibit contemporary art but also spark dialogue and engagement within the community. The decision to house this cultural center in the old fish market, a neoclassical structure designed by engineer Pompeo Mancini and built between 1821 and 1823, was both symbolic and strategic. The building's temple-like architecture, complete with robust columns, provides a striking backdrop for the ever-evolving exhibitions within.

A Journey Through Time and Art

Since its inauguration, the Centro Arti Visive Pescheria has hosted a myriad of exhibitions, initially focusing on summer showcases featuring artists like Eliseo Mattiacci, Mauro Staccioli, and Luigi Mainolfi. As the center grew, so did its reputation, drawing both national and international artists to its halls. In 1999, the Pesaro City Council officially established the Centro Arti Visive Pescheria as a municipal institution, paving the way for further expansion and development.

Expansion and Innovation

The early 2000s marked a period of significant growth for the Centro Arti Visive Pescheria. Under the artistic direction of Ludovico Pratesi, the center underwent renovations that included the annexation of the adjacent Chiesa del Suffragio, a decagonal church that added a spiritual dimension to the artistic experience. This expansion allowed for a broader range of exhibitions and events, including the innovative Quadri al buio sul mare Adriatico by Enzo Cucchi.

Joining the AMACI Network

In 2006, the Centro Arti Visive Pescheria became part of the prestigious Association of Italian Contemporary Art Museums (AMACI), joining the ranks of Italy's most esteemed art institutions. This affiliation brought a new wave of exhibitions featuring international artists such as Tony Cragg and Candida Höfer, further cementing the center's status as a hub for contemporary art.

A Dynamic Cultural Space

Today, the Centro Arti Visive Pescheria continues to thrive as a dynamic space for artistic expression and cultural exchange. The center hosts a diverse array of events throughout the year, from art exhibitions to performances in music, design, theater, and dance. Its role as a cultural observatory ensures that it remains at the forefront of contemporary artistic trends, providing a platform for both emerging and established artists to showcase their work.
